Abstract

The embodiment of the invention discloses a mental disease authentication method and related equipment based on data processing, wherein the method comprises the following steps: and receiving a qualification authentication request of the mental diseases from the user to be authenticated, wherein the qualification authentication request carries qualification authentication data of the user to be authenticated aiming at the mental diseases. Further, the server may detect whether the qualification data has detection data associated with the target psychotic disorder authentication rule, and when the server detects that the qualification data has detection data, analyze the detection data to determine whether the detection data matches the target psychotic disorder authentication rule, if the server determines that the detection data matches the target psychotic disorder authentication rule, determine that qualification authentication of the psychotic disorder of the user to be authenticated is successful, and send a medical insurance reimbursement instruction for the target psychotic disorder to the medical insurance platform. The invention is beneficial to improving the authentication efficiency of mental diseases.

Technical Field
The invention relates to the technical field of computers, in particular to a mental disease authentication method based on data processing and related equipment.
Background
At present, manual authentication is generally adopted when qualification authentication is carried out on mental diseases of ginseng and security personnel, and the manual authentication mode is complicated. For the social security staff, the manual authentication mode can increase the workload of the staff and has lower efficiency. For the paramedics, the manner of manual authentication often requires the paramedics to wait for a longer period of time to transact the mental disorder authentication qualifications.

In one embodiment, the preset psychotic disorder authentication rules may include 3 types, that is, a first preset psychotic disorder authentication rule, a second preset psychotic disorder authentication rule, and a third preset psychotic disorder authentication rule, each of which is used to determine a type of psychotic disorder. Wherein, each preset mental disease authentication rule corresponds to the number condition and the preset disease symptoms of the user. Illustratively, the first preset psychotic disorder authentication rules may be as shown in table 3-1 for determining schizophrenia, the second preset psychotic disorder authentication rules may be as shown in table 3-2, and the third preset psychotic disorder authentication rules may be as shown in table 3-3.
TABLE 2-1
TABLE 2-2
Tables 2 to 3
In one embodiment, the target psychotic disorder certification rule is a schizophrenia certification rule, which is shown in table 3-1. Wherein: a C45-associated disorder, a C46 delusions, a C47-affective disorder, a C48 hallucinations, a C49-behavioural disorder, a C50 hypovolemia, a C51-psychotic disorder with a period of duration of more than 1 month, a C52-brain-organic-free psychotic disorder, a C53-body-disorder-induced psychotic disorder, a C54-substance-free psychotic disorder, a C55-substance-independent psychotic disorder, and a C56-substance-free psychotic disorder with impaired self-awareness and/or social function as preset disease symptoms corresponding to the rule of authenticating schizophrenia. The condition that C45.about.C50 >2+ (C51.about.C55) is the number condition corresponding to the rule for authenticating schizophrenia (namely, the condition for authenticating schizophrenia) means that the first number of the first target symptoms in the symptoms of C45.about.C50 exists in the user, and the sum of the second number of the second target symptoms in the symptoms of C51.about.C55 exists in the user and 2 is larger. In this case, when the server detects that the detection data exists in the qualification data, the detection data is analyzed, and it is determined that the disease symptoms of the disease suffered by the user to be authenticated include 7 disease symptoms such as C45 association disorder, C46 delusions, C47 affective disorder, C48 hallucinations, C49 behavioral disorder, C50 hypovolemia and C52 brain-free organic mental disorder, and further, the server compares the 7 disease symptoms with preset disease symptoms one by one, so as to obtain 7 disease symptoms which are the same as the preset disease symptoms in the 7 disease symptoms, wherein: the first number is 6, the second number is 1, and further, the server judges that the first number 6>2+1 (namely the second number), namely the number of the disease symptoms which are the same as the preset disease symptoms in the 7 disease symptoms meets the number condition indicated by the target mental disease authentication rule, and further, the detection data is matched with the target mental disease authentication rule.
In one embodiment, the target psychotic disorder authentication rule is a paranoid psychotic disorder authentication rule, which is shown in table 3-2. Wherein: delusions of the C56 system, C57 compliance with symptomatic criteria have been sustained for 3 months or more, C58 organic-free psychotic disorder, C59 schizophrenic or affective psychotic disorder and psychotic disorder caused by C60 psychotic substance-free/substance-independent psychotic disorder is a preset disease symptom corresponding to paranoid psychotic disorder certification rules. The C56+C57+ (C58-C60) >3 is a quantity condition corresponding to the paranoid type psychotic disorder authentication rule (i.e., a paranoid type psychotic disorder quantity condition), meaning that the sum of the first quantity of the user with the C56, the second quantity with the C57 and the third quantity with the third target symptom of the C58-C60 symptoms is greater than the quantity threshold 3. In this case, when the server detects that the detection data exists in the qualification data, the detection data is analyzed, it is determined that the disease symptoms of the disease suffered by the user to be authenticated include 4 disease symptoms such as 56 delusions of the system, C57 compliance with the symptom standard has been sustained for 3 months or more, C58 no organic mental disorder, C59 no schizophrenia or affective mental disorder, and the like, further, the server compares the 4 disease symptoms with preset disease symptoms one by one, and the number of disease symptoms identical to the preset disease symptoms in the 4 disease symptoms is 4, where: the first number is 1, the second number is 1, the third number is 2, and further, the server judges that the sum of the first number, the second number and the third number is 4 and is greater than a number threshold value 3, namely, it is determined that the number of disease symptoms identical to the preset disease symptoms in the 4 disease symptoms meets the number condition indicated by the paranoid type mental disorder authentication rule, and further it is determined that the detection data is matched with the paranoid type mental disorder authentication rule.
In one embodiment, the target psychotic disorder authentication rules are mood disorder authentication rules, which are shown in table 3-1. Wherein: the C61 accords with the preset disease symptoms corresponding to the mental disorder authentication rules, wherein the mania duration is greater than or equal to 1 week, the mixed episode of C62 mania and depression, the episode of C63 depression is greater than or equal to 2 weeks, the mental disorder caused by C64 inorganic mental disorder and C65 mental active substance-free/non-dependent substance-free mental disorder is the mental disorder. The (C61+C62+C63) >1+ (C64+C65) is a number condition corresponding to the mood disorder authentication rule (i.e., a mood disorder number condition), meaning that the first number of first target symptoms in the symptoms of C61-C63 of the user is larger than the sum of the second number of second target symptoms in the symptoms of C64-C65 of the user and 1. In this case, when the server detects that the detection data exists in the qualification data, the detection data is analyzed, it is determined that the disease symptoms of the disease suffered by the user to be authenticated include 4 disease symptoms such as C61 meeting mania lasting for 1 week or more, C62 mania and mixed episode of depression, C63 depressive episode lasting for 2 weeks or more, and C64 inorganic mental disorder, and the like, and further, the server compares the 4 disease symptoms with preset disease symptoms one by one, so as to obtain 4 disease symptoms identical to the preset disease symptoms in the 4 disease symptoms, wherein: the first number is 3, the second number is 1, and further, the server judges that the first number 3>1+1 (namely the second number), namely, the number of disease symptoms identical to the preset disease symptoms in the 4 disease symptoms meets the number condition indicated by the mood disorder authentication rule, and further, the detection data is matched with the mood disorder authentication rule.

In one embodiment, the target mental disease authentication rule corresponds to K preset disease symptoms, where K is a positive integer greater than N, and the developer may set a priority for the K preset disease symptoms in advance, and set a disease symptom N before the priority ranking of the K preset disease symptoms as a first preset disease symptom. In this case, when the server detects that the detection data exists in the qualification certification data, the detection data may be parsed to determine M disease symptoms of the disease suffered by the user to be certified, and detect whether the number M of the disease symptoms is greater than or equal to a preset number corresponding to the first preset disease symptoms, if so, detect whether the number identical to the first preset disease symptoms in the M disease symptoms is equal to the preset number, and if the number identical to the first preset disease symptoms in the M disease symptoms is equal to the preset number, determine that the detection data matches with the target mental disease certification rule. In this way, it is unnecessary to compare the detected number with all preset disease symptoms corresponding to the target psychotic disorder authentication rule, and only the first N of all preset disease symptoms need to be compared, so that the calculation overhead can be reduced.
Illustratively, the target psychotic disorder certification rule corresponds to 11 (i.e., K is 11) preset disease symptoms, which are respectively C45 associative disorder, C46 delusions, C47 affective disorder, C48 hallucinations, C49 behavioral disorder, C50 hypovolemia, a period of C51 mental disorder lasting for more than 1 month, C52 brain-free organic mental disorder, C53 mental disorder caused by somatic disorder, C54 mental disorder caused by mental active substance-free disorder, and C55 mental disorder caused by non-dependent substance-free disorder; the priorities set in advance for the 11 preset disease symptoms are respectively from optimal to better: psychotic disorders with C55 non-dependent substance, C45 associated disorder, C46 delusions, C47 affective disorder, C48 hallucinations, C49 behavioral disorder, C50 hypovolemia, C51 psychotic disorder with duration of more than 1 month, C52 organic-free psychotic disorder, psychotic disorder with C53 somatic disorder, and psychotic disorder with C54 psychotic disorder with psychotic active substance; wherein, the disease symptom of the pre-priority ranking front 7 (i.e. N is 7) in the 11 preset disease symptoms is set as the first preset disease symptom, that is, the first preset disease symptom is: c55 without substance-independent psychotic disorder, C45-associated disorder, C46 delusions, C47 affective disorder, C48 hallucinations, C49 behavioral disorder and C50 hypovolemia; the first predetermined disease symptoms correspond to a predetermined number of 6. In this case, when the server detects that the detection data exists in the qualification certification data, the detection data is analyzed, and 8 (i.e. M is 7) disease symptoms of the disease suffered by the user to be certified are determined, which are respectively: the server determines that m=8 is greater than a preset number 6 corresponding to a first preset disease symptom, the server can further detect that the same number of 8 disease symptoms as the first preset disease symptom is 7, the same number of 7 as the first preset disease symptom is greater than a preset number 6, and the detection data can be determined to match the target psychotic disorder authentication rule.
